The Source of True Wisdom

The book of Proverbs begins with an invitation to seek wisdom at its source. Proverbs 2:6 teaches, “For the Lord gives wisdom; from His mouth come knowledge and understanding.” This simple yet profound statement reminds us that wisdom is not gained by human ambition but is a gift bestowed by God. It begins with reverence for Him and humility before His Word.

According to Proverbs 9:10, “The fear of the Lord is the beginning of wisdom, and the knowledge of the Holy One is understanding.” The fear of the Lord is not terror but awe, respect, and honor toward God. It means recognizing His authority and trusting His guidance above our own understanding. When a believer humbly acknowledges their need for God’s counsel, true wisdom begins to take root in the heart.

Practically speaking, seeking divine wisdom requires spending time in Scripture, prayer, and godly fellowship. God's Word transforms our thinking, while prayer invites the Holy Spirit to teach and guide us in truth.

God’s Wisdom Revealed in Creation

The majesty of creation itself reflects the endless wisdom of God. Psalm 104:24 proclaims, “How many are your works, Lord! In wisdom you made them all; the earth is full of your creatures.” Every sunrise, every rhythm of nature, and every detail of creation displays a design so intricate that only divine wisdom could conceive it.

Job 12:13 further declares, “To God belong wisdom and power; counsel and understanding are His.” In creation, we see the harmony of all things working according to His command. This reveals that God's wisdom is not random but purposeful. He orders all things for His glory and for the good of those who love Him.

For believers, reflecting on creation can strengthen faith and trust in God’s plan. Just as He carefully orchestrated the universe, He also works purposefully in our lives, even when His wisdom may not be fully understood in the moment.

The Wisdom of God in Jesus Christ

The New Testament reveals that God’s wisdom is personified in Jesus Christ. The apostle Paul writes in 1 Corinthians 1:24, “Christ the power of God and the wisdom of God.” Jesus is the living expression of divine wisdom, demonstrating in His words and actions how God thinks, loves, and redeems.

Through His life, death, and resurrection, Jesus revealed a wisdom that confounded the world. While human wisdom looks for strength and success, God’s wisdom was displayed in humility and sacrifice. Paul reminds us in 1 Corinthians 1:27 that “God chose the foolish things of the world to shame the wise.” The cross, which seemed foolish to many, became the ultimate revelation of divine strategy and love.

Believers are invited to live by that same wisdom through their union with Christ. James 3:17 says, “The wisdom that comes from heaven is first pure, then peace loving, considerate, submissive, full of mercy and good fruit, impartial and sincere.” This heavenly wisdom transforms our character and enables us to live in harmony with others. It teaches humility, compassion, and obedience to the will of God.

Seeking God’s Guidance Through Prayer

Every believer desires to make wise choices, but human wisdom often falls short. James 1:5 provides a timeless promise: “If any of you lacks wisdom, you should ask God, who gives generously to all without finding fault, and it will be given to you.” Divine wisdom is available to every person who seeks it in faith.

Prayer is the key to unlocking heavenly guidance. It is through quiet moments with God that clarity replaces confusion. When we bring our plans before Him, He directs our steps and aligns our hearts with His will. Proverbs 3:5–6 encourages us, “Trust in the Lord with all your heart and lean not on your own understanding; in all your ways submit to Him, and He will make your paths straight.”

In daily life, this means pausing before decisions, asking God for understanding, and waiting on His timing. Spiritual wisdom is not rushed. It grows in patience and trust.

Living Out God’s Wisdom in a Modern World

Modern culture often equates wisdom with intelligence, success, or experience. Yet the wisdom that comes from God operates by different principles. It is grounded in truth, humility, and righteousness. God’s wisdom teaches love over pride, purity over compromise, and peace over conflict.

To live out God’s wisdom today, believers can practice the following:

  1. Spend time daily in God’s Word to renew your mind.
  2. Pray continually for discernment and understanding.
  3. Surround yourself with godly influences and mentors.
  4. Seek to apply biblical principles in every decision.
  5. Practice humility, knowing that true wisdom begins with dependence on God.

When Christians choose to value God’s wisdom more than the world’s opinions, they reflect His light and help others find the path of truth.
